A student choosing B.Com in Financial Accounting at Gokhale Centenary College (GCC) Ankola enters a 3-year full-time course in Ankola, Karnataka. Early learning covers financial accounting; later work develops business management. The academic fee is INR 90,000. Entry requires 10+2.
